html,body
{
	height: 100%;
}
body,table,tr,td,th
{
	font-weight: normal;
	font-size: 11px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
}
img
{
	display: block;
	border: 0;
}
form
{
	margin: 0;
}
.input_text,textarea
{
	font-size: 10px;
	background-color: #f7f7f7;
	color: #1c5777;
	padding: 0 3px 0 3px;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
}
.input_select
{
	font-size: 10px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
}
.style_grey
{
	font-weight: normal;
	font-size: 11px;
	color: #7f7f7f;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
}
small
{
	font-weight: normal;
	font-size: 9px;
	color: #000000;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
}
.norm,a.norm_underline:hover
{
	font-weight: normal;
	font-size: 11px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.norm:hover,.norm_underline
{
	font-weight: normal;
	font-size: 11px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.norm_small,a.norm_small_underline:hover
{
	font-weight: normal;
	font-size: 9px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.norm_small:hover,.norm_small_underline
{
	font-weight: normal;
	font-size: 9px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.light,a.light_underline:hover
{
	font-weight: normal;
	font-size: 11px;
	color: #bababa;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.light:hover,.light_underline
{
	font-weight: normal;
	font-size: 11px;
	color: #bababa;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.cat,a.cat_underline:hover
{
	font-weight: normal;
	font-size: 11px;
	color: #1c5777;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.cat:hover,.cat_underline
{
	font-weight: normal;
	font-size: 11px;
	color: #1C5777;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.bold,a.bold_underline:hover
{
	font-weight: bold;
	font-size: 11px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.bold:hover,.bold_underline
{
	font-weight: bold;
	font-size: 11px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.bold_small,a.bold_small_underline:hover
{
	font-weight: bold;
	font-size: 9px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.bold_small:hover,.bold_small_underline
{
	font-weight: bold;
	font-size: 9px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.greeny,a.greeny_underline:hover
{
	font-weight: bold;
	font-size: 11px;
	color: #1C5779;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.greeny:hover,.greeny_underline
{
	font-weight: bold;
	font-size: 11px;
	color: #1C5779;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.large,a.large_underline:hover
{
	font-weight: normal;
	font-size: 13px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.large:hover,.large_underline
{
	font-weight: normal;
	font-size: 13px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}
.large_bold,a.large_bold_underline:hover
{
	font-weight: bold;
	font-size: 13px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: none;
}
a.large_bold:hover,.large_bold_underline
{
	font-weight: bold;
	font-size: 13px;
	color: #5e5e5e;
	font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if;
	text-decoration: underline;
}